摘要
Refers to a process for the production of Ceramic Products such as Floor Coverings, walls and fixtures with antibacterial and Antifungal Properties, antimicrobial, which includes Molding, drying, Baking and glazing Agent from Clay and Glaze S HydrationWhere in the glazing is added to the surface of the Ceramic Article Copper particles of spherical Shape are standardized in a range from 0.5 to 1.5 mm in diameter or Copper particles in cylindrical Shape that are in a range from 0.5 to 1.5 mm in diameter and from 0.5 to 1,5 mm length in a relationship of Copper on the surface of the Ceramic Article between 1 mg and 10 mg in weight per cm2 of the surface of ceramics.This procedure allows providing particles of Copper to Ceramic Products in the glazing without particles are oxidized completely at the stage of Baking and without releasing the Enamel Surface by Mechanical action
